Maoist programmes terrorising people: Sitaula

Home Minister Krishna Prasad Sitaula has said the recently announced protest programmes of the Maoists have terrorised the people instead of creating atmosphere for constituent assembly polls.



Home Minister Situala speaking during the programme. nepalnews.com/ANA
Speaking at the Reporters' Club on Thursday, Sitaula urged the Maoist leadership to withdraw all the protest programmes immediately and join in the campaigns for holding election in a free and fair manner. He said parties should not create terror in people.

Stating that such programmes would restrict people from casting their votes in the polls, Sitaula asked the Maoists to be serious about the elections.

The Maoist programmes announced on Saturday demanding establishment of republic before the election have drawn criticism from various quarters that such programmes would end up disrupting the polls.

He further said the government was determined to improve security for the polls at any cost.

In another context, Sitaula said process for nationalisation of the property owned by late King Birendra and Queen Aishworya and present King Gyanendra has begun. He said the ministerial committee had started collecting the details of the properties, which would be finalised soon.

On the occasion, the Reporters Club handed over Rs 100,001 aid to the flood victims. nepalnews.com ia Aug 23 07

But the question is: Can the present governmnet go far enough? What else can it do? Whether one admits it or not, doing away with the institution of monarchy is not as easy as the SPA+Maoist leadership make it to be because of these factors:

1. Domestic: It is not quite clear what percentage of our population wants the King to go. There's a lot of ambiguity here. What I feel is, there's a lot of anger towards the King, but there's a lot of sympathy/goodwill for the institution. Maybe the majority in Rolpa, Rukum, Salyan, Pyuthan wants the King to go, but Nepal is not REPRESENTED by these 4--OK 20--districts and its population, or the angry mobs that stage protests and Nepal bandh everyday.

Let's not judge the mood of all Nepali people based on young Ratnapark-Tundikhel protesters and their "anti-monarchy" slogans.

[If we are to run a comparative political analysis, Nepal's case now is quite similar to Japan in 1945. The majority wanted Hirohito to abdicate, but was not against the idea of monarchy. ]

2. International factor: Does India really want monarchy abolished? I don't think so. No matter what it says, the GOI knows that having a King is in its best interests. The main opposition party BJP still supports the King and anything the Indian govt. does or tries to do to support the republcian forces will be opposed by the BJP and its "militant-Hindu- Nationalists' affiliates.

If the SPA really wanted the King to go, why didn't they do it when the House was restored? Why couldn't they do it that day? They did not because they knew they could not because of the domestic and international factors. Also for the parties, monrachy is their last resort if --IF- the maoists decide to break away from the alliance and go back to their old ways.

Just my views. Feel free to disagree.
